Electrochemical Mechanism Of The Oxygen Bubble Formation At The Interface Between Oxidic Melts And Zirconium Silicate Refractories

Tests have indicated a reaction mechanism based on internal reduction of polyvalent ionic zirconium silicate impurities and oxidation of oxide ions of the melt at the zirconium silicate surface.
